RAL 530-3 vs RAL 470-5
Side-by-side comparison of RAL 530-3 and RAL 470-5. Click on a color to view its full details page.
Color Comparison
With a Delta E of 10.3, these colors are very different. Both colors belong to the Red hue family. RAL 530-3 has a neutral temperature while RAL 470-5 has a warm temperature. Both colors have similar brightness with LRV values of 6.4 and 8.9. RAL 470-5 is more saturated (65%) than RAL 530-3 (35%).
